Australians on the Board as Keeneland November Breeding Stock Sale Gets Underway

Mark Smith - Thursday November 11

The sales action moved to the Keeneland November Breeding Stock Sale on Wednesday, with a few familiar names making the scoreboard.

Lot 2 John Muir's Milburn Creek, in association with Nicoma, was quick off the blocks purchasing Raymundo's Secret for US$310,000.

The daughter of the Galileo stallion Treasure Beach was sold as a racing or broodmare prospect.

Raymundo's Secret won three of her five starts at three and at four she added the Grade II John C Mabee Stakes for an overall record of five wins in ten starts with earnings of over $200,000.

Lot 46 Active at the Fasig-Tipton Sale, Newgate Farm and SF Bloodstock were in the thick of the action again purchasing the well-performed Tonalist mare Tonalist's Shape for $350,000.

 

Undefeated in three starts at two, Tonalist's Shape won the Grade II Davona Dale Stakes and Grade III Forward Gal Stakes at three.

Sold as a racing or broodmare prospect, Tonalist's Shape banked just shy of $400,000. She is a daughter of the stakes-winning Harlan’s Holiday mare Hitechnoweenie.

Lot 62. Julian Blaxland took a fancy to the Grade III winning Acclamation mare Abby Hatcher (IRE), who he secured for $185,000.

Out of the 3-time winning Dubawi mare Sharqawiyah, Abby Hatcher (IRE) is a half-sister to the smart 2yo filly Purciaretta (Cotai Glory), a winner of four from seven starts in Italy highlighted Premio Divino Amore Livermore.

Lot 80 Kestrel Thoroughbreds look to have spotted a pinhook opportunity with the purchase of a weanling colt by War Front for $170,000.

Out of the winning Dynaformer mare Bourbonesque, the colt is a half-brother to the Grade 1 Awesome Again Stakes winner, Mongolian Groom (Hightail).

Lot 134 Paul Moroney and Catheryne Bruggeman outlaid $260,000 for the stakes-winning Stormy Atlantic mare Ippodamia's Girl.

Sold as a racing or broodmare prospect, Ippodamia's Girl banked over $260,000 from five wins.

She is a half-sister to the Grade 1 Del Mar Futurity Stakes winner Georgie Boy (Tribal Rule) out of the stakes-winning Peterhof mare Ippodamia.

Lot 185 Newgate Farm and SF Bloodstock struck again with the purchase of the stakes winning Orb mare Mrs Orb for $1850,000.

Sold as a racing or broodmare prospect, Mrs Orb has earned over $535,000 from five wins.

Lot 224c Also going the way of Newgate Farm and SF Bloodstock is the $130,000 purchase Quinta Nota (Tale of Ekati).

The winner of the Grade 1 Clasico Enrique Ayulo Pardo and runner-up in the Grade 1 Clasico Pamplona in Peru at two, Quinta Nota is out of the winning Perfect Soul mare Belle Soul a half-sister to Canada’s champion 3-year-old colt, Not Boubon (Not Impossible).
